How they compare

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123) currently reports 58.02 million against 868,837 in Ecuador, a difference of 57.15 million.

That makes 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)'s figure about 66.8 times Ecuador's.

Across all 50 years both countries report, 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123) has been ahead every year.

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123) ranks 74th and Ecuador ranks 71st of 221 groups.

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123) has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123) Ecuador Difference Ahead
1970s 14.80 million 602,449 14.19 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)
1980s 21.81 million 848,622 20.96 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)
1990s 26.51 million 946,912 25.56 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)
2000s 33.27 million 1.02 million 32.25 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)
2010s 44.88 million 1.02 million 43.85 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)
2020s 55.56 million 915,213 54.65 million ECA: Oil Producing Economies (unsdcode:98123)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Enrolment in primary education, male (number) with 667 missing years estimated by linear interpolation between the nearest real observations. Only gaps of 4 years or fewer are filled, and never beyond the first or last actual measurement — these are filled holes, not forecasts.
